Before the incident
While in a seated position the injured coworker was performing grinding work.
What happened
The grinding wheel came off of the hand grinder the coworker was using and struck the injured coworkers left knee.
Injury or illness
Laceration to left knee.
Object or substance involved
Grinding wheel coming off of the grinder.
Summary line
Grinding wheel came off grinder and struck the coworkers left knee resulting in a laceration.
